Smoke alarms Install smoke alarms on every level of your home, including outside of sleeping areas. Make sure smoke alarms meet the needs of everyone in your family, including those with disabilities. What is the worst that could happen if I don’t winterize my sprinkler / irrigation system? In short form, your system could be severely damaged and may not work at all in the spring. Energy Efficiency is the first reason. A dirty filter can restrict air flow resulting in increased energy costs. You can save a 5-20% off of your utility bills by having your furnace run more efficiently. Prolonged longevity of your HVAC system. Leaves and twigs can build up over time and clog your home’s gutters and downspouts. You may also notice sections of the gutters are leaking, are sagging or have separated from the house.
